To determine the initial value and rate of change of the linear function, we need to find the y-intercept (initial value) and the slope (rate of change) of the line from the graph.
From the graph, we can see that the y-intercept is at point (0, 2) and a second point at (1, 4).
To find the slope, we can use the formula:
slope = (y2 - y1) / (x2 - x1)
slope = (4 - 2) / (1 - 0) = 2 / 1 = 2
So, the rate of change of the linear function is 2.
To find the initial value, we can use the y-intercept point (0, 2).
Therefore, the initial value is 2 and the rate of change is 2.
